Fluorescence in situ hybridization (FISH)
Test Includes:
Fluorescence in situ hybridization (FISH) for ac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L), targeting rearrangement of BCR/ABL, KMT2A (mLL), CMYC and numerical changes of chromosome 6 and 21q deletion

Uses FISH to detect chromosomal abnormalities in ALL. Aids in diagnosis, risk stratification, and treatment planning.
Blood, Bone Marrow, CSF fixed-cell pellet from a cytogenetic analysis slide with metaphase and/or interphase nuclei or Bone Marrow touch preparation Slides are acceptable for testing
10 mL blood (pediatric), 3 mL bone marrow, fixed-cell pellet from a cytogenetic analysis, 8 slides with metaphase and/or interphase nuclei or 8 touch preparation slides.
Green-top (sodium heparin) tube, pediatric Vacutainer® is optimal or lavender-top (EDTA) tube (suboptimal). Adjust tube size to sample volume to avoid heparin toxicity.
